Latest Patents
Elias Amselem holds a patent for a method titled "Phenotypic characterization of cells." This patent involves the use of a microfluidic device that captures biological material, including target cells, from a sample. The method allows for the identification of target cells exhibiting specific phenotypic characteristics by monitoring biological material in cell compartments before the addition of a test agent. This innovative approach ensures that the phenotypic response of target cells is accurately determined without interference from other cells or non-cell material present in the sample.
